Activities - how the charity spends its money
CTST projects: Happy at Home (befriending service for isolated elderly people); Key2Life (foodbank, school uniforms, holiday food and activities); Street Angels (supporting those in need on Saturday nights); Nurturing Dementia: interfaith projects. Affiliated charities: Key Project (homeless young people): South Tyneside Asylum Seeker Refugee Church Help. One off events, hustings.

Charitable objects
1) THE ADVANCEMENT OF THE CHRISTIAN RELIGION FOR THE PUBLIC BENEFIT IN SOUTH TYNESIDE. 2) THE PROMOTION OF RELIGIOUS HARMONY FOR THE BENEFIT OF THE PUBLIC BY: A) EDUCATING THE PUBLIC IN DIFFERENT RELIGIOUS BELIEFS INCLUDING AN AWARENESS OF THEIR DISTINCTIVE FEATURES AND THEIR COMMON GROUND TO PROMOTE GOOD RELATIONS BETWEEN PERSONS OF DIFFERENT FAITHS. B) PROMOTING KNOWLEDGE AND MUTUAL UNDERSTANDING AND RESPECT OF THE BELIEFS AND PRACTICES OF DIFFERENT RELIGIOUS FAITHS.
